Oh, the magic of the holiday season! Preparing a festive Christmas buffet is more than just cooking; it’s about gathering friends and family around the table, sharing laughter, and creating memories that will last a lifetime. There’s something truly special about a spread that brings everyone together, and this buffet is designed to do just that! Picture a beautifully roasted turkey, fluffy mashed potatoes, and creamy green bean casserole, all served alongside sweet cranberry sauce and a slice of pumpkin pie for dessert. It’s a delightful mix of flavors and textures that will warm hearts and fill bellies. Trust me, this unique spread will be the highlight of your holiday celebrations, making every bite a joyful experience. Let’s dive into the delicious details that will make your Christmas gathering unforgettable!
Ingredients List
For our festive Christmas buffet, you’ll need a delightful array of ingredients to create a meal that everyone will love. Here’s what you’ll need:
- Roast turkey: 1 whole (12-14 lbs) – This is the star of the show, so make sure to get a good-quality bird!
- Stuffing: 2 cups – You can use store-bought or homemade. I love a savory stuffing with herbs for that classic flavor.
- Mashed potatoes: 4 cups – Creamy, buttery, and oh-so-satisfying. Don’t skimp on the butter and milk!
- Green bean casserole: 2 cups – A holiday favorite! You can make it from scratch or use a quick recipe if you’re short on time.
- Cranberry sauce: 1 cup – Freshly made or canned, this adds a sweet-tart balance to the savory dishes.
- Pumpkin pie: 1 whole – A must-have dessert that finishes the meal on a sweet note.
- Gravy: 2 cups – Made from the turkey drippings for that rich, savory goodness!
Gather these ingredients, and you’ll be well on your way to a memorable holiday feast! If you want to add your own twist, feel free to mix in some of your favorite sides!
How to Prepare Instructions
Now, let’s get to the fun part: preparing your festive Christmas buffet! Here’s a simple step-by-step guide to help you create this delicious spread, ensuring everything is perfectly timed and ready to impress your guests.
- Preheat your oven: First things first, preheat your oven to 350°F (175°C). This is essential for roasting that turkey to perfection!
- Prepare the turkey: While the oven heats up, season your turkey inside and out with salt, pepper, and your favorite herbs. This is where you can really make it flavorful!
- Stuff the turkey: Loosely pack the stuffing into the cavity of the turkey. Don’t overstuff it—this allows for even cooking.
- Roast the turkey: Place the turkey on a rack in a roasting pan and put it in the oven. Roast for about 3 hours or until the internal temperature reaches 165°F (75°C). If you have a meat thermometer, now’s the time to use it!
- Mashed potatoes time: While the turkey is roasting, peel and chop your potatoes. Boil them in salted water until tender, then drain and mash with butter and milk until creamy. Keep them warm!
- Green bean casserole: Prepare your green bean casserole according to your favorite recipe. If you’re short on time, you can pop it in the oven during the last 30 minutes of the turkey’s cooking time.
- Prepare the cranberry sauce: If you’re making your cranberry sauce from scratch, do this while the turkey roasts. Combine cranberries, sugar, and a splash of water, then simmer until the berries burst and thicken.
- Make the gravy: Once the turkey is done, remove it from the oven and let it rest for at least 20 minutes. Meanwhile, use the drippings in the roasting pan to make your gravy!
- Slice the pumpkin pie: Finally, don’t forget about dessert! Slice the pumpkin pie right before serving to keep it fresh and inviting.
And there you have it! A beautifully prepared Christmas buffet that’s sure to delight. Make sure to time everything well so that all the dishes are hot and ready to serve when your guests arrive!
Why You’ll Love This Recipe
This festive Christmas buffet isn’t just about the food; it’s about creating a joyful atmosphere that brings everyone together. Here are some reasons why this spread will be the highlight of your holiday celebration:
- Festive Flair: The vibrant colors and mouthwatering aromas of this buffet create a warm, inviting atmosphere that screams holiday cheer!
- Something for Everyone: With a variety of dishes—from savory turkey to sweet pumpkin pie—there’s guaranteed to be something to satisfy every palate.
- Perfect for Large Gatherings: This buffet is designed to feed a crowd, making it the ideal choice for family gatherings, holiday parties, or cozy get-togethers with friends.
- Make-Ahead Potential: Many of the dishes can be prepared in advance, allowing you to enjoy the festivities rather than being stuck in the kitchen when guests arrive.
- Tradition Meets Creativity: While this buffet features classic recipes, you can easily add your own personal twist, making it uniquely yours.
- Heartwarming Memories: Sharing this meal with loved ones will create cherished memories, making the holiday season even more magical.
Trust me, this Christmas buffet will not only fill bellies but also warm hearts, making it the perfect centerpiece for your holiday festivities!
Tips for Success
To make your festive Christmas buffet truly shine, here are some handy tips that have worked wonders for me!
- Prep Ahead: Many dishes can be made a day or two in advance. Consider preparing the stuffing and cranberry sauce ahead of time, so you can focus on roasting the turkey on the big day.
- Timing is Key: Plan your cooking schedule carefully. Start with the turkey since it takes the longest, and work your way to the quicker sides. A little planning goes a long way in keeping everything hot and ready!
- Taste as You Go: Don’t forget to adjust seasonings as you prepare. Every turkey and stuffing recipe can be a bit different, so trust your taste buds!
- Rest the Turkey: Letting the turkey rest after roasting is crucial. This helps the juices redistribute, ensuring every slice is moist and flavorful.
- Don’t Overcrowd the Oven: If you’re baking multiple dishes, make sure to stagger cooking times. This way, everything can cook evenly without getting too crowded.
With these tips in your back pocket, you’ll be well on your way to hosting a stunning Christmas buffet that everyone will rave about!
Storage & Reheating Instructions
After the festivities wind down, you’ll likely have some delicious leftovers from your festive Christmas buffet. Here’s how to store and reheat everything to keep those flavors just as delightful as when they first came out of the oven!
First, let your turkey and any hot dishes cool down to room temperature before storing. This helps maintain their texture and flavor. Once cooled, carve the turkey into slices and place it in an airtight container. Make sure to include any stuffing and sides in separate containers to keep everything fresh.
For the mashed potatoes and green bean casserole, you can also store them in airtight containers. If you’re worried about them drying out in the fridge, a splash of milk in the potatoes can help keep them creamy when you reheat!
Store your cranberry sauce in a covered jar or container, and the same goes for the gravy—just make sure to let it cool before sealing. Everything should be refrigerated within two hours of serving to ensure safety.
When it’s time to indulge again, preheat your oven to 350°F (175°C). Place the turkey slices in a baking dish, cover with foil, and reheat for about 20-25 minutes, or until heated through. For the mashed potatoes and green bean casserole, you can reheat them in the oven as well or pop them in the microwave. Just remember to stir occasionally to heat evenly!
And there you have it! With these storage and reheating tips, you can enjoy your Christmas buffet leftovers just as much as the first time around. Nothing beats a second helping of holiday cheer!
Nutritional Information
When indulging in this festive Christmas buffet, you might be curious about what you’re putting on your plate. A typical serving offers around 750 calories, with 35g of fat and 40g of protein to keep you feeling satisfied. You’ll also find about 80g of carbohydrates, including 5g of fiber, making it a hearty meal. Keep in mind that these values can vary based on the specific ingredients and portion sizes used, so feel free to adjust according to your dietary needs. Enjoy every delicious bite!
FAQ Section
As you get ready to create your festive Christmas buffet, you might have a few questions. Don’t worry; I’ve got you covered! Here are some common queries and my best answers to help you on your culinary journey.
How do I know when the turkey is cooked properly?
The best way to ensure your turkey is cooked through is to use a meat thermometer. Insert it into the thickest part of the thigh without touching the bone. You’re aiming for an internal temperature of 165°F (75°C). If you don’t have a thermometer, make sure the juices run clear when you cut into the turkey.
What alternative side dishes can I serve?
If you’re looking for some variety, consider adding roasted vegetables like carrots and Brussels sprouts, or a light salad with holiday flavors such as pomegranate and candied nuts. Mashed sweet potatoes are also a delightful twist that adds color and sweetness to your Christmas buffet.
Can I prepare any dishes ahead of time?
Absolutely! Many components of your buffet can be made ahead. I recommend preparing the stuffing, cranberry sauce, and even the mashed potatoes a day or two in advance. Just store them in the fridge and reheat before serving, saving you time on the big day.
What’s the best way to reheat the leftovers?
For reheating, the oven is your best friend! Preheat to 350°F (175°C), cover your turkey slices with foil in a baking dish, and heat for 20-25 minutes. For sides like mashed potatoes and green bean casserole, you can reheat them in the oven or microwave, stirring occasionally for even heating.
Can I use a frozen turkey?
Yes, you can! Just make sure to thaw it safely in the fridge for several days before cooking. A good rule of thumb is to allow 24 hours of thawing time for every 4-5 pounds of turkey. This ensures the meat stays juicy and flavorful for your Christmas buffet.
Now you’re all set with answers to common questions, making your holiday preparations smoother and more enjoyable!
Serving Suggestions
To elevate your festive Christmas buffet, consider adding a few complementary dishes that will delight your guests even more! A fresh, crispy salad with mixed greens, cranberries, and a zesty vinaigrette can be a refreshing counterpoint to the rich flavors of your main dishes. Roasted or glazed carrots bring a pop of color and sweetness that harmonizes beautifully with the savory turkey.
For drinks, a warm spiced apple cider or a classic eggnog is a wonderful way to keep the holiday spirit alive. If you prefer something lighter, a sparkling cranberry mocktail is not only festive, but it also adds a fun, effervescent touch to the celebration! These additions will round out your buffet, ensuring a memorable and joyous dining experience for everyone gathered around your table.
Print
Christmas Buffet: 7 Heartwarming Dishes to Impress
- Total Time: 3 hours 30 minutes
- Yield: 10 servings
- Diet: None
Description
A festive spread of dishes perfect for a Christmas celebration.
Ingredients
- Roast turkey – 1 whole (12-14 lbs)
- Stuffing – 2 cups
- Mashed potatoes – 4 cups
- Green bean casserole – 2 cups
- Cranberry sauce – 1 cup
- Pumpkin pie – 1 whole
- Gravy – 2 cups
Instructions
- Preheat the oven to 350°F (175°C).
- Prepare the turkey by seasoning it inside and out.
- Stuff the turkey with the prepared stuffing.
- Roast the turkey for about 3 hours or until the internal temperature reaches 165°F (75°C).
- Prepare the mashed potatoes by boiling potatoes and mashing them with butter and milk.
- Make the green bean casserole and bake according to the recipe.
- Serve cranberry sauce alongside the turkey.
- Prepare gravy from the turkey drippings.
- Slice the pumpkin pie and serve for dessert.
Notes
- Let the turkey rest before carving.
- Make sides ahead of time to save on prep.
- Adjust seasonings to taste.
- Prep Time: 30 minutes
- Cook Time: 3 hours
- Category: Main Course
- Method: Roasting
- Cuisine: American
Nutrition
- Serving Size: 1 plate
- Calories: 750
- Sugar: 15g
- Sodium: 900mg
- Fat: 35g
- Saturated Fat: 10g
- Unsaturated Fat: 20g
- Trans Fat: 0g
- Carbohydrates: 80g
- Fiber: 5g
- Protein: 40g
- Cholesterol: 150mg
Keywords: christmas buffet











